Output 840a6ef3b3f8b313dee03c833051686230031d60da34ea69a32004b12404dc27:0

value
12723633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a5974993e86cea438f833bba6f9fd5f8a63fb6 OP_EQUAL
address
3585J6xYD7DdAfNHm76d5v8Lxcyt6Wo1MA
transaction
840a6ef3b3f8b313dee03c833051686230031d60da34ea69a32004b12404dc27
spent
true